Passenger load on buses, trains plunges on 1st day of holiday amid COVID

The passenger load on buses and trains around Taiwan fell to less than 20 percent Saturday, the first day of the three-day long Dragon Boat Festival weekend, after the government urged people to avoid long distance travel in the wake of an outbreak of indigenous COVID-19 cases.
